Transaction 1d0630f915ae321b54e4e17b5bf43f975d0e862411c50f57667d4b2f18b4d4d5

2 Input
1 Outputs
  • 1d0630f915ae321b54e4e17b5bf43f975d0e862411c50f57667d4b2f18b4d4d5:0
  • value  23647909
    address  1DGs7MEq4i2MxmmgCdRgRdkzQ4Cj5BZAba